    What is the Kansas Food Assistance Program? The Food Assistance Program helps people with little or no income. It provides benefits to eligible individuals and families to buy nutritious food, even vegetable plants and seeds, from local grocery stores.     The Food Stamp Act of 1977 is now called the Food and Nutrition Act of 2008. In Kansas, the program is called the Food Assistance Program. Benefits of the Food Assistance Program are 100% federally funded.
